    Essential Firefox Privacy Tweaks Mozilla Firefox is a highly flexible web browser for privacy customization. Adjusting its settings can significantly cut down on the amount of data corporate trackers and advertisers collect about your online habits. 1. Upgrade Enhanced Tracking Protection

    Firefox has a built-in defense system called Enhanced Tracking Protection (ETP). By default, it is set to Standard, but switching it to Strict provides much stronger defense.

    What it does: Blocks social media trackers, cross-site tracking cookies, fingerprinters, and tracking content hidden inside ads or videos across all windows. How to change it:

    Click the three-line menu button (hamburger menu) in the top-right corner.

    Open Firefox Settings and select Privacy & Security from the left sidebar.

    Under Enhanced Tracking Protection, change the selection from Standard to Strict.

    Click the Reload All Tabs button if prompted to apply changes.

    Note: If a specific trusted website stops loading correctly, you can click the shield icon to the left of your URL address bar and turn off ETP just for that site. 2. Enable Global Privacy Control (GPC)

    Understanding BurnPlot: Tracking Deflationary Token Metrics Visually

    Deflationary tokens have changed how investors view asset scarcity in the cryptocurrency ecosystem. By permanently removing tokens from circulation through automated or manual mechanisms, these projects aim to create upward price pressure over time. However, tracking these metrics via raw blockchain data or simple text spreadsheets can be incredibly difficult.

    Enter BurnPlot—a powerful visual methodology designed to transform complex cryptographic burn data into intuitive, actionable charts. What is a BurnPlot?

    A BurnPlot is a specialized data visualization framework used to track, analyze, and predict the supply reduction mechanics of deflationary cryptocurrencies. Instead of looking at isolated daily burn numbers, a BurnPlot synthesizes multiple data points into a single, cohesive visual interface. It allows investors, developers, and analysts to see exactly how fast a token supply is shrinking relative to time, trading volume, and market cap. Core Metrics Tracked by BurnPlot

    To build an accurate visual representation of a token’s deflationary health, BurnPlot aggregates several critical on-chain metrics:

    Cumulative Burn Volume: The total number of tokens sent to dead addresses (like 0x000…000) since inception.

    Burn Velocity: The rate at which tokens are destroyed over a specific timeframe (e.g., hourly, daily, or weekly).

    Supply Decay Curve: A mathematical trendline showing the projected remaining circulating supply over time.

    Volume-to-Burn Ratio: A metric that correlates trading volume with burn efficiency, vital for tokens with transaction-tax burn mechanisms. The Components of a BurnPlot Visualization

    A standard BurnPlot graph typically utilizes a multi-axis system to display the interaction between supply and economic activity: 1. The X-Axis: Time and Blocks

    The horizontal axis maps out time increments or blockchain block numbers. This provides a chronological timeline to observe how specific events—such as protocol upgrades, exchange listings, or market crashes—impacted the token’s burn rate. 2. The Primary Y-Axis: Circulating Supply

    This axis tracks the downward trajectory of the total circulating supply. Seeing this line slope downward provides immediate visual confirmation of the asset’s deflationary mechanics at work. 3. The Secondary Y-Axis: Burn Velocity

    Represented either by a secondary line or a histogram at the bottom of the plot, this tracks the daily spikes in token destruction. High spikes often correlate with high market volatility or massive network utility. Why Visual Tracking Matters for Investors

    Looking at a smart contract’s raw code or a block explorer text log doesn’t tell the whole story. Visualizing deflationary metrics through a BurnPlot offers three distinct advantages:

    Spotting Fake Deflation: Some projects boast high burn rates but suffer from massive unlock schedules or hidden mint functions. A BurnPlot exposes whether the circulating supply is actually decreasing or if inflation is outpacing the burn.

    Predicting Scarcity Milestones: By analyzing the slope of the Supply Decay Curve, investors can visually estimate when the token will hit critical scarcity thresholds (e.g., when 50% of the supply is burned).

    Assessing Protocol Health: A healthy deflationary token should show a strong correlation between network adoption and burn velocity. If adoption grows but the burn line flattens, it indicates a flaw in the tokenomics engine. The Future of Tokenomics Analysis

    As token models become more complex—incorporating dynamic burns based on gas fees, algorithmic rebases, or NFT interactions—static statistics are no longer sufficient. Tools and charts utilizing the BurnPlot framework give the crypto community the clarity it needs. By turning abstract blockchain data into clean, visual insights, BurnPlot helps investors cut through marketing hype and evaluate deflationary assets based on real economic reality.

    The C function memset() is one of the most frequently used tools for clearing memory, yet it is also a notorious source of subtle bugs and security vulnerabilities. While it appears straightforward, compiler optimizations and type misunderstandings can lead to silent failures.

    Here is what you need to know to avoid common memory clearing errors. The Compiler Can Erase Your Code (Dead Store Elimination)

    The most dangerous error occurs when using memset() to clear sensitive data, such as passwords or cryptographic keys, before a buffer goes out of scope.

    void process_password() { char password[64]; get_password(password); // … do work … memset(password, 0, sizeof(password)); // Dangerous! } Use code with caution.

    Modern compilers use an optimization called Dead Store Elimination. If the compiler detects that the password buffer is never read again after the memset() call, it may completely remove the function call from the compiled binary. The memory remains uncleared, leaving sensitive data vulnerable to RAM-scraping attacks.

    The Fix: Use secure alternatives designed to prevent compiler optimization, such as memset_s() (introduced in C11) or platform-specific functions like ExplicitZeroMemory() (Windows). The Wrong Size Trap

    Another frequent bug involves passing an incorrect size argument, particularly when clearing dynamically allocated memory or arrays passed to functions.

    void clear_buffer(intarray) { // BUG: sizeof(array) returns the size of the pointer, not the array! memset(array, 0, sizeof(array)); } Use code with caution.

    In C, arrays decay into pointers when passed to functions. Calling sizeof(array) inside the function yields the size of a pointer (typically 4 or 8 bytes) rather than the actual memory block.

    The Fix: Always pass the explicit byte size to the function, or multiply the number of elements by the element size: memset(array, 0, num_elements * sizeof(int));. The Byte-by-Byte Misconception

    memset() fills memory byte by byte. It works perfectly for setting memory to zero (0) or clearing character arrays. However, it cannot be used to initialize non-char arrays to non-zero values. int matrix[10]; memset(matrix, 1, sizeof(matrix)); // BUG! Use code with caution.

    You might expect this to fill the array with the integer 1. Instead, memset() copies the byte value 0x01 into every single byte of the integer. On a 32-bit system, each integer becomes 0x01010101 (decimal 16,843,009) instead of 1.

    The Fix: Use a simple standard loop, or use specific initialization functions if your language platform provides them. Overwriting Complex Structures

    Using memset() on structures containing pointers or virtual tables can corrupt your program’s memory structure.

    struct Session { std::string username; int id; }; Session s; memset(&s, 0, sizeof(s)); // BUG! Destroys internal string pointers. Use code with caution.

    In C++, clearing an object that contains non-trivial types (like std::string, std::vector, or virtual functions) breaks the internal state of those objects. It wipes out pointers to heap memory, leading to instant memory leaks and crashes.

    The Fix: Use proper constructors, initializer lists, or assign values directly instead of force-clearing the structure’s memory footprint.

    SEO keywords are the specific words and phrases that people type into search engines to find information, products, or services online. In search engine optimization (SEO), businesses and content creators research these terms to naturally integrate them into their web pages. This strategy signals relevance to search algorithms, driving organic traffic and ensuring content reaches the right audience. Types of Keywords by Length

    Short-Tail Keywords: Broad, high-level terms usually spanning one to two words (e.g., “shoes”). They attract massive search volume but come with intense competition and lower conversion rates.

    Long-Tail Keywords: Specific, targeted phrases containing three or more words (e.g., “best running shoes for flat feet”). They have lower search volumes but attract highly motivated users, making them easier to rank for. Types of Keywords by Search Intent

    Understanding search intent—the reason behind a user’s query—shapes how content should be written:

    Informational: Queries where users want to learn or find answers (e.g., “how to clean leather shoes”).

    Navigational: Searches targeting a specific website or brand name directly (e.g., “Nike login”).

    Commercial Investigation: Queries used to compare options and research products before buying (e.g., “Nike vs Adidas running shoes”).

    Transactional: High-value searches indicating the user is ready to buy or take immediate action (e.g., “buy Nike Pegasus size 10”). Core Metrics to Evaluate Keywords
